Friday: Cardinals (Kyle Lohse, 10-2, 3.61 ERA) at Pirates (Zach Duke, 4-5, 4.23 ERA), 6:05 p.m. CT
Saturday: Cardinals (Todd Wellemeyer, 7-4, 3.94) at Pirates (Phil Dumatrait, 3-4, 5.26), 6:05 p.m. CT
Sunday: Cardinals (Joel Pineiro, 3-4, 4.17) at Pirates (Ian Snell, 3-7, 5.84), 12:35 p.m. CT

Cardinals HR Leaders by year:

2007:
Albert Pujols: 32
Chris Duncan: 21
Ryan Ludwick: 14
Jim Edmonds: 12
Rick Ankiel: 11

2006:
Albert Pujols: 49
Scott Rolen: 22
Chris Duncan: 22
Jim Edmonds: 19
Juan Encarnacion: 19

2005:
Albert Pujols: 41
Jim Edmonds: 29
Reggie Sanders: 21
Larry Walker: 15

So, you really only have to go back to 2006. But, it's still a great year for the Cards as far as HRs go. Ludwick, Ankiel, and Pujols are all on pace for 35-40+ HRs.
